Abstract

Methods, systems, and apparatus, including computer programs encoded on computer storage media, for performing highlight recovery. One of the methods includes receiving raw image data of an image, the raw image data comprising, for each of a plurality of highlight regions in the image, original channel values for one or more channels of the highlight region; processing the raw image data to generate updated image data, wherein the updated image data comprises updated channel values for each highlight region in the image, and wherein, for each of one or more highlight regions of the image, one or more updated channel values of the highlight region exceed a maximum channel value according to a predetermined data precision; and performing a hue correction process on the updated channel values of the one or more highlight regions of the image to generate final channel values that satisfy the predetermined data precision.
